store:
location:
Home
>
7-11
>
Missouri
> MEHLVILLE
7-11 in MEHLVILLE, Missouri
6197 LEMAY FERRY ROAD @ BAUMGARTNER
MEHLVILLE - 63129
View Details
4328 TELEGRAPH RD
MEHLVILLE - 63129-2649
View Details